What is an Registered Agent?
An agent registered is a appointed individual or firm that acts as a communication link for a business entity, including a corporation or limited liability company. The registered agent is responsible for collecting significant legal documents, which include service of process, tax notifications, and regulatory communications from the government. By having a registered agent, business owners make sure that they maintain a valid legal presence and can quickly respond to possible legal matters.
Registered agents can be people, for example business owners or representatives, or they can be specialized firms that specialize in registered agent offerings. Businesses often decide to hire the registered agent provider for the added benefit of discretion and professionalism, as using a professional registered agent allows business owners to keep their personal information away from public records. This is particularly helpful for businesses operating in various states, as a nationwide registered agent can streamline compliance across regions.

Costs Associated with Registered Agent Solutions
When evaluating registered agent services, understanding the associated costs is crucial for businesses regardless of size. It is vital to assess both the initial and ongoing expenses. Numerous registered agent providers assess an annual fee that typically ranges from 50 to 500 dollars, based on the services offered and the level of expertise provided. Some companies may also have setup fees, while others might bundle these costs into the annual fee for convenience.
Alongside standard service charges, businesses should consider any additional costs that may come up. These could include charges for particular services such as mail forwarding, compliance reminders, or document handling. Some registered agent companies offer supplementary services such as annual compliance filings and expert consultation, which can enhance overall business operations but may increase overall costs. Budgeting for these possible extras is a smart decision to guarantee that all necessary services are adequately covered.

Widespread Misconceptions about Registered Agents
Many entrepreneurs think that hiring a registered agent is solely necessary for big corporations. This misconception overlooks the reality that inclusive of small businesses and LLCs are obligated by law to appoint a registered agent to accept crucial legal documents. Regardless of the size of the business, adherence with state regulations requires having a reliable agent in place to ensure timely handling of essential communications.
A further misconception is that registered agents merely provide minimal services, such as accepting and forwarding legal documents. In reality, many registered agent providers offer a wide range of solutions that include annual compliance services, business mail handling, and even entity management services. These extra offerings can significantly streamline the compliance process and assist companies keep good standing with state authorities.
Some entrepreneurs assume that using a registered agent is costly and unnecessary. However, there are numerous affordable registered agent services on the market that serve all types of businesses. The cost of keeping a registered agent is frequently far less than the potential penalties linked to failing to comply with state requirements. By utilizing expert registered agent services, businesses can save money and avoid the hassle of legal complications down the road.

Besides residency and having a physical location, numerous states have requirements regarding the registered agent's availability. The majority of states mandate that a registered representative be available during regular office hours to receive legal papers, notifications, and additional important messages. This requirement highlights the significance of reliability, as inability to be available can lead to missed opportunities for judicial action or regulatory alerts, which may adversely impact the company.
The process for appointing or altering a registered agent likewise differs by state. Generally, companies must complete a registered representative change document and file it with the right state agency, along with any applicable charges. Some regions provide a buffer period for companies to appoint a new registered representative without incurring penalties. Understanding these nuances is essential for keeping good standing and ensuring smooth operations for any company.
